SiT8009B
High Frequency, Low Power Oscillator
ow Power, Standard Frequency Oscillator Features
Applications
◼ 100% pin-to-pin drop-in replacement to quartz-based XO ◼ Excellent total frequency stability as low as ±20 ppm ◼ Operating temperature from -40°C to 85°C. For 125°C
and/or -55°C options, refer to SiT8919 and SiT8921 ◼ Low power consumption of 4.9 mA typical at 1.8 V ◼ Standby mode for longer battery life ◼ Fast startup time of 5 ms ◼ LV
CMOS/H
CMOS compatible output ◼ Industry-standard packages: 2.0 x 1.6, 2.5 x 2.0,
3.2 x 2.5, 5.0 x 3.2, 7.0 x 5.0 mm x mm ◼ Instant samples with Time Machine II and field program-
mable oscillators ◼ RoHS and REACH compliant, Pb-free, Halogen-free and
Antimony-free ◼ For AEC-Q100 oscillators, refer to SiT8924 and SiT8925
◼ Ideal for GPON/EPON, network switches, routers. servers, embedded systems
◼ Ideal for Ethernet, PCI-E, DDR, etc.
